
pH Paper and other Test Strips
Single-use test materials used to rapidly and semi-qualitatively determine the acidity or alkalinity of liquids or to measure another parameter or substance; may include tests for starch, chlorine, and molybdenum; usually via the use of color-based reactions.
pH Papers, pH strips, pH sticks, and pH test kits are used in laboratory, industrial, and educational environments to qualitatively assess pH levels or monitor acid-base titrations in a range of sample types.pH Buffer reference standards are used for the accurate calibration of pH meters and monitors for far more precise and quantitative pH measurement.
pH Test papers are supplied either as rolls, tear-off strips, or sticks. They are impregnated with indicator dyes that change color at a specific pH. In some products, indicator dyes are covalently linked to cellulose fibers to avoid bleed-out (leaching) and contamination of the test sample.
Some pH papers indicate simple acid or base conditions with a single red-to-blue color change (also called litmus papers). Universal pH papers and strips contain a combination of indicators that cover a range of pH values up to and including 0 to 14 in a single test. The observed color change is checked against a comparison chart supplied with the papers.
Alternatively, for metered assessments of pH, standard or reference pH buffers are used to calibrate pH meters and other electrochemical sensors.
Standard Buffer Characteristics:
• Typically supplied at fixed values of pH 4.01, pH 7.00, and pH 10.01
• May be color-coded for easy and quick identification
• Certified to their nominal pH and accuracy at a specified temperature (typically 20°C)
• Supplied as ready-to-use solutions or concentrates
• Contain antifungals for extended shelf life

EMS Immuno Mount with strong anti-fading agent, 1, 4-phenylenediamine (PPD) is an aqueous mounting medium for preserving fluorescence of tissue and cell smears. This unique formula prevents rapid photobleaching of FITC, Texas Red, AMCA, Alexa fluoro 488, Alexa fluoro 594, tetramethyly rhodamine, and Redox. The fluorescence is retained during prolonged storage at 4 degree C in the dark. This medium contains phenylenediamine and is not suitable for immunofluorescence of Cy dyes, Phycoerythrin (R-PE), phyocyanin (PC), and allophycocyanin (APC).
Application: Immunofluorescence, confocal microscopy
Reagent: Ready to use mounting medium with dark coffee color. This color does not interfere with Immunofluorescence.
Refractive Index: 1.400 +/- 0.002 (These numbers apply to these mounting mediums in solution).
